Australian Olympic swimmer Madeline Groves has accused two of the country's leading coaches of misconduct and lifted the lid on what she says is a culture of "misogyny" and "perversion" in the sport. In an exclusive interview with the ABC, Groves also revealed that she was sexually abused from the age of 13 by a person who still works in swimming. It is the first time the dual Olympic medallist has elaborated on her explosive social media posts in June, when she withdrew from the trials for the Tokyo Olympic Games, "as a lesson to misogynistic perverts and their bootlickers".
